EntityTypeBuilder.HasBaseType 方法

定义

重载

HasBaseType(Type)

设置继承层次结构中此实体类型的基类型。

HasBaseType(String)

设置继承层次结构中此实体类型的基类型。

HasBaseType(Type)

设置继承层次结构中此实体类型的基类型。

public virtual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der HasBaseType (Type entityType);
public virtual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der HasBaseType (Type? entityType);
abstract member HasBaseType : Type ->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der
override this.HasBaseType : Type ->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der
Public Overridable Function HasBaseType (entityType As Type) As EntityTypeBuilder

参数

entityType
Type

基类型 或 null ,表示无基类型。

返回

同一个生成器实例,以便可以链接多个配置调用。

适用于

HasBaseType(String)

设置继承层次结构中此实体类型的基类型。

public virtual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der HasBaseType (string name);
public virtual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der HasBaseType (string? name);
abstract member HasBaseType : string ->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der
override this.HasBaseType : string -> Microsoft.EntityFrameworkCore.Metadata.Builders.EntityTypeBuilder
Public Overridable Function HasBaseType (name As String) As EntityTypeBuilder

参数

name
String

基类型的名称或 null ,表示没有基类型。

返回

同一个生成器实例,以便可以链接多个配置调用。

适用于